Author and educator Kirsty Loehr joins Jaimie to share her beautifully messy story of queer family building — from reciprocal IVF with her ex-wife to co-parenting their 4-year-old son and now navigating life in a blended family with her new partner and her partner’s two kids.Kirsty talks candidly about the breakup that came just months after welcoming her son, the challenges of 50/50 custody, and learning to blend families while balancing love, chaos, and new beginnings. She also shares the inspiration behind her new book, A Short History of Queer Parenting, a funny, accessible, and essential look at how queer families have always existed — even when history tried to erase us.It’s honest, hopeful, and very, very lesbian.🏳️‍🌈 Key TakeawaysReciprocal IVF and Family Dynamics: Kirsty shares her experiences with reciprocal IVF, offering insights into queer parenting and the unique challenges and triumphs they bring.Single and Blended Parenting: Insights into the evolution from single to blended parenting, discussing both the struggles and profound bonds formed.Legal Aspects of Queer Parenting: Legal navigation within queer parenting, particularly regarding reciprocal IVF and parental rights.The Evolution of Queer Parenting: Kirsty's new book highlights the historical journey of LGBTQ+ parenting, from legality issues to personal anecdotes, providing a comprehensive view of queer family growth.Strength in Community: The importance of shared experiences and community support in navigating the complexities of queer family life.🏳️‍🌈 About the Guest(s)🏳️‍🌈Kirsty Loehr (she/her) is a writer, English teacher, and examiner based in Brighton, England. She’s the author of A Short History of Queer Parenting and A Short History of Queer Women.
